Wine tasting is an art that requires greater than just a keen sense of style. Participating with totally different varieties and styles provides an opportunity to appreciate the subtleties of flavor, aroma, and texture. A comprehensive guide to winery wine tasting techniques will equip enthusiasts with the mandatory skills and data to boost the tasting experience.
Understanding the fundamentals of wine tasting begins with familiarity with the necessary thing parts. The primary components contributing to flavor are sweetness, acidity, tannin, and alcohol - Relax at the Scenic Vineyards of California's Wine Country. Every wine has its unique balance, influenced by the grape variety, region, and vinification course of. Recognizing these components allows a taster to appreciate the complexity in every sip.

Visible examination is the first step within the tasting course of. Swirling the wine in a glass oxygenates it, bringing out the aromas which are crucial to understanding the wine's essence. Observing colours starting from deep purple to pale straw offers perception into the wine's age and variety. The clarity and brilliance of the wine also offer clues about its high quality.
Next, the olfactory experience takes priority. The nose is usually thought of probably the most essential part of tasting. Constructing an awareness of widespread aromas could be beneficial. Fruits, flowers, spices, and earthy notes are sometimes current. Taking time to inhale deeply before tasting allows for a extra profound appreciation of a wine's bouquet.

When it comes to tasting, the method ought to be deliberate and considerate. Small sips are advisable, allowing the wine to linger in the mouth. This technique permits the taster to discern the complicated layers of flavors. Noting the preliminary taste, the mid-palate, and the finish contributes to an entire understanding of the wine’s profile.
Another crucial side of wine tasting is the understanding of stability and structure. A well-balanced wine presents harmonious flavors the place no single element overwhelms the others. Analyzing how acidity interacts with sweetness and tannins will help in assessing the general composition of the wine.
Wines can differ significantly from one vintage to another as a outcome of environmental factors, which makes understanding the idea of terroir essential. Terroir refers back to the geographical and weather conditions, in addition to the winemaking practices that have an result on the final product. This relationship between the land and the wine can affect its flavor spectrum dramatically.

Pairing wine with food can improve the tasting experience considerably. Sure wines complement particular dishes, which might elevate both the food and the wine. Understanding flavor profiles will permit enthusiasts to create exciting pairings. For instance, a wealthy purple wine might pair superbly with a hearty meat dish, while a crisp white might improve the taste of seafood. Learn About Sustainable Wine Practices in Sonoma County.
Collaborating in guided tastings can also provide useful insights. Many wineries provide professional-led tastings, the place skilled sommeliers share their experience. Engaging with knowledgeable hosts allows for a deeper understanding of the wines and presents the possibility to ask questions and exchange views.
Documentation throughout tastings can serve as a useful tool. Keeping notes on the wines sampled, along with personal impressions, enhances the tasting journey. This document helps in recalling what one enjoyed or did not enjoy, creating a personal roadmap for future wine exploration. Tasting sheets are often used as a structured approach to seize this data.
Attending wine-focused events, corresponding to festivals or expos, creates a possibility to discover an unlimited range of wines and meet fellow enthusiasts. Networking with industry professionals and passionate hobbyists can lead to sharing insights and expanding one’s palate. The festive atmosphere enhances the communal aspect of wine appreciation.

- Start by observing the wine’s appearance; tilt the glass to assess clarity, color intensity, and viscosity as these elements can indicate the wine's age and body.
- Swirl the wine gently within the glass to release its fragrant compounds, enhancing the olfactory experience.
- Take a second to inhale the aromas earlier than tasting; note the complexity and the primary scent classes corresponding to fruity, earthy, floral, or spicy.
- When tasting, permit a small quantity of wine to cover your palate, ensuring to be aware of the initial style, mid-palate flavors, and finish to evaluate its construction.
- Pay consideration to the tannins current; they will affect the texture and mouthfeel, giving insights into the wine's growing older potential.
- Consider the acidity stage, which may present freshness to the wine, balancing sweetness and enhancing food pairings.
- Use a scorecard or journal to jot down observations about each wine, including flavors, aromas, and personal impressions to check later.
- Experiment with food pairings throughout tastings, as this can considerably enhance or change the notion of the wine’s flavor profile.
- Interact in discussions with fellow tasters to share views, which can broaden the appreciation and understanding of various wines.

To properly smell wine, observe these steps: first, hold the glass on the base, swirl it gently to aerate, then bring it to your nostril. Take a couple of brief sniffs to capture the preliminary fragrances, followed by a deeper inhale to explore the extra complicated aromas. Focus on identifying particular scents like fruits, spices, and other descriptors.

What ought to I search for when tasting wine?
When tasting wine, search for a quantity of key components: look (color and clarity), aroma (fruits, herbs, and spices), flavor (sweetness, acidity, tannins), and texture (body and mouthfeel). Moreover, think about the wine's finish, which is the lingering taste after swallowing. All these components contribute to the wine's general profile.
How do I know if a wine is good quality?
Good high quality wine usually has balance among its parts, that means that acidity, tannins, sweetness, and alcohol work harmoniously collectively. Look for complexity in flavors and aromas and a long, pleasant end. High Quality wines also typically exhibit distinct traits reflecting their varietal and area.

Is it necessary to use specific glassware for wine tasting?
Yes, using specific glassware enhances the wine tasting experience. Applicable glasses can affect the aroma and flavor notion. For example, a Bordeaux glass is designed to reinforce full-bodied purple wines by permitting oxygen to interact with them, whereas a narrower flute is right for glowing wines to protect carbonation.

What are some common wine tasting errors to avoid?
Common wine tasting errors include not correctly cleaning your palate between wines, serving wines at incorrect temperatures, and overlooking the significance of the glass form. Moreover, being overly influenced by others' opinions can cloud your own tasting experience; at all times trust your personal palate.

Am I Able To taste wines at a winery with out making a reservation?
While some wineries supply walk-in tastings, many require reservations, especially on weekends or throughout peak seasons. It’s best to verify ahead with the winery for his or her policies on tastings to make sure a smooth experience. Reservations additionally permit you to have a more personalized and academic visit.
